Transaction ece49898ee17a36862f326aec9cf7b5c88d27589fe0380973e21879eb723575f
1 Input
1 Output
-
ece49898ee17a36862f326aec9cf7b5c88d27589fe0380973e21879eb723575f:0
- value
- 150837
- script pubkey
- OP_0 OP_PUSHBYTES_20 05e78be2869d439664e8b04ce1f6d5d56be4150f
- address
- bc1qqhnchc5xn4peve8gkpxwrak46447g9g0ry5uyv